There are so many to choose from. My husband I stayed at a hostel in Botafogo. It was the best for us since we were in Rio for 10 days and didn't spend much time in the hostel.
It was very comfortable, safe, close to the metro and beach, in a good neighborhood, and affordable. You can find good hostels on-line if that is what you're looking for.
It took 10-15 minutes for us to get to the consulate from there.
